January 3 Episode Recap

The first episode of MC Fireside Chats this 2024 presents a comprehensive discussion on the outdoor hospitality industry. The episode features insightful contributions from industry experts Mike Harrison, Sandy Ellingson, and Scott Bahr, each bringing a unique perspective to the table.

Host Brian Searl sets the stage for the conversation, emphasizing the show’s focus on providing valuable insights for business success in the outdoor hospitality sector. He introduces the panel, highlighting their expertise and the value they bring to the discussion. The conversation begins with a look at the current state of the RV and camping industry, with each guest sharing their observations and experiences.

Mike Harrison, with his extensive background in luxury RV resorts, offers insights into the trends and challenges facing the industry. He discusses the impact of external events, such as election years, on travel and camping patterns. Mike’s analysis provides a nuanced understanding of how luxury travel and camping are influenced by broader societal trends.

Sandy Ellingson brings a wealth of experience in campground operations and marketing. She highlights the challenges campgrounds face in adapting to changing market conditions, especially in the realm of digital marketing. Sandy’s perspective is particularly valuable in understanding the need for effective online presence and marketing strategies in the industry.

Scott Bahr, an expert in market research, delves into the data-driven aspects of the industry. He shares insights from his research on guest reviews and behavior, emphasizing the importance of understanding customer feedback. Scott’s contribution is crucial in highlighting how data analysis can inform better business practices in outdoor hospitality.

The conversation also touches on the evolving preferences of campers and RVers. The panel discusses the shift from traditional RV camping to alternatives like glamping, and how this impacts the industry. This part of the discussion underscores the need for campgrounds to adapt and cater to a diverse range of customer preferences.

A significant portion of the discussion is dedicated to the role of technology in enhancing the camping experience. The panelists explore the potential of AI and other technological advancements in improving convenience and efficiency for both campers and campground operators. Brian, in particular, shares his enthusiasm for the possibilities that AI presents in revolutionizing the industry.

The panelists also discuss the importance of education and knowledge sharing within the industry. They emphasize the need for tailored educational efforts to address the varying levels of experience and knowledge among campground owners and operators. This part of the conversation highlights the ongoing need for professional development in the industry.

Another key topic is the trend of bundling offerings and hosting events in campgrounds. The panelists explore how this approach, inspired by the cruise industry, can enhance customer retention and generate recurring revenue. This discussion points to the innovative strategies campgrounds can adopt to stay competitive.

The conversation concludes with a focus on future trends and predictions for the industry. The panelists share their thoughts on what 2024 might hold for outdoor hospitality, discussing potential growth areas and challenges. This forward-looking discussion provides valuable insights for industry stakeholders planning for the future.

About MC Fireside Chats

MC Fireside Chats is a weekly show devoted to the outdoor hospitality industry, hosted by Brian Searl, founder and CEO of Insider Perks and Modern Campground. 

MC Fireside Chats airs live every Wednesday at 2 p.m. Eastern Time, and features guests from the camping and RV industry who share their take on the current state of the camping, glamping, and RVing sectors as well as upcoming innovations in RV parks, campgrounds, outdoor resorts, glamping, and the RV industry.
